Graphitized Petroleum Coke

graphitepetroleumcoke Graphitized Petroleum Coke (GPC) is a high-quality carbonaceous material derived from high-temperature treatment of petroleum coke. The process of graphitization involves heating raw petroleum coke to elevated temperatures (typically above 2500 degrees Celsius). This results in the rearrangement of the carbon atoms, converting the amorphous carbon structure of petroleum coke into a crystalline graphite structure.
Key properties of graphitized petroleum coke include:
1. High Carbon Content: GPC typically has a very high carbon content, exceeding 99%. This makes it a valuable material in industries where high purity and carbon content are essential.
2. Low Impurities: The graphitization process removes most of the impurities present in the raw petroleum coke, resulting in a material with low sulfur, nitrogen, and other volatile content.
3. Excellent Thermal Conductivity: Graphitized coke has high thermal conductivity, making it suitable for applications where efficient heat transfer is crucial & electrical conductivity is essential.
4. Good Lubricating Properties: The lubricating properties of graphite are utilized in certain applications, and GPC can be employed in the production of graphite lubricants.
The primary applications of graphitized petroleum coke include:
1. Manufacturing of Graphite Electrodes: GPC is a crucial raw material in the production of graphite electrodes used in electric arc furnaces for steel production. Graphite electrodes conduct electric current and provide the necessary heat for the melting process.
2. Production of Carbon Raisers: GPC is used as a carbon additive in the production of carbon raisers, which are added to molten metal during steelmaking to adjust carbon content.
3. Other Industrial Applications: GPC may find use in other industrial applications requiring high-purity carbon with excellent thermal and electrical conductivity.
Graphitized petroleum coke is a valuable material in industries that require high-performance carbonaceous materials.
